Saavvii for MSWord - Even faster keyboard shortcuts!

This application is great. I have always been a keyboard junkie, avoiding the mouse as much as possible. Under MSWord 2003 and prior versions, I was able to do just about everything with the keyboard and rarely needed the mouse. This all changed with Office 2007 and the blasted "Ribbon". The keyboard shortcuts largely changed (to nonsensical combinations) and it became near impossible to find the function I wanted.

Enter SAAVVII. This little utility lets you call it up with the hotkey sequence of your choice, and type in plaintext commands like "insert 2x3 table" or "edit header" or whatever you like. No instructions, but they're largely unnecessary. As long as you don't try to get silly and trick it, Saavvii will generally figure out what you want to do and do it. Handy.

iPod Shuffles Indestructible?

I have an iPod Shuffle (2G) that I've been using for my 430am trips to the gym for over a year now. I have managed to leave it in my shorts and washed / dried it no less than half a dozen times. Every time it comes out dead, but if I give it a day to dry out it will re-sync and keep on playing just fine. You just can't kill these things!
